No, you do not have to play SimCity4 or almost any other game purchased via Steam, directly off Steam for them to work (unless the particular game has a multiplayer mode and you WANT to play multiplayer). You can choose to play it (SimCity4) offline (and for that matter set Steam to offline mode) and only choose to go online on Steam when you WANT to.

@TekindusT Did you by chance try installing to a custom folder (NOT including .../Program Files or .../Program Files (x86))? In other words install directly into something like C:/SimCity 4 and NOT C:/Program Files (x86)/SimCity 4 This of course assumes that Windows 10 still uses the goofy .../Program Files sub-folders. -

You can disable the steam overlay by right clicking your game in the steam library, properties and uncheck "Enable the Steam overlay while ingame" in the general tab. I've done that since the beginning and I am able to use the backward option. Thank you. Thank you. Thank you. I've been trying to figure out how to disable that annoying overlay for several games, but it really irritated me with the SimCity4 NAM menus. Now, I can Shift-Tab backwards thru those long NAM menu choices when I fat-finger the TAB key. -

I've been off-line from Steam playing games for more than a month at a time with no issues. The only thing that you now miss out on are updates which at times can be a real nuisance since they are erratically automatic (you're supposed to be able to disable automatic updates from Steam, but it sometimes goes ahead and does so anyway, hence my setting it to offline mode until I deliberately decide to go online to check for updates at a more convenient time should they be available). I suspect others have more issues due to their usage of user account controls within Windoze. which can be mostly avoided by NOT installing Steam into the default ...\Program Files (x86)... folder. edit: I have close to 20 games purchased thru Steam in the last 5 years and all of them run just fine (offline in single player mode). I rarely play online except to placate a couple of grandsons who are occasionally up for a Civ IV Beyond the Sword game. I suppose those that like head-to-head online might not like the auto-update feature of Steam that much either especially IF it's an update for the game they are getting ready to play (because once that update starts, there is no playing of THAT game until the update has completed). If it's NOT the game they are getting ready to play, the auto update is not that much of a hindrance since Steam is defaulted to pause downloading while any game play of any game is proceeding. -

Don't know about the Origin installation but you have a mistaken misconception about Steam DRM. You can now download any of their games and play any them ON or OFF line no complications at all and I don't have to worry about where the original disk went. I almost always start my games with Steam in Offline mode. SimCity 4 Deluxe works almost flawlessly with the installation in the /Steam/Steamapps... folder and the My Documents/SimCity4/plugin folder is identical in use to a non Steam installation. The ONLY negative I'm finding with a Steam installation is the diversion of Shift-Tab for Steam purposes interferes with reverse tabbing thru some long menu selection if you accidentally TAB thru the menu selection you were looking for. p.s. Regarding demand modifiers... Are the industry doubler/quadrupler's considered demand cap modifiers? I would think that all they do is change/modify the number of workers in those classes of industry buildings so that you don't need as many of those buildings to satisfy a specific demand cap level. Also, I specifically searched and found SimGoober's BSC Irrigation Ditch Set based on a post that you (@A Nonny Moose) made commenting that you were using it with no issues with your rural settings. For sure, the SG BSC Irrigation Ditch set is a mod based on lots containing demand modifiers specifically designed to counter SimCity's negative bias against Industry-Agriculture as the urban population grows. Are you still using it or did it skew (IR) demand too much? FYI, I have both the SPIC irrigation mod (which doesn't have demand modifier lots) and SimGoober's BSC Irrigation Ditch Set (which does have demand modifier lots).
